## Summary - add a release-published workflow that prepares and submits Winget manifest updates automatically - poll the GitHub Release API for the stable Windows Tauri asset and compute its SHA-256 before submission - document the maintainer secret and repository variables needed for the Winget automation flow ## Validation - `node --check "scripts/winget/resolve-release-asset.cjs"` - `node "scripts/winget/resolve-release-asset.cjs" --help` - dry-run resolver against the published `v0.16.0` release asset ## Notes - skips draft and prerelease GitHub releases - uses the maintainer fork submission flow for `microsoft/winget-pkgs` - live PR submission still depends on configuring `WINGET_GITHUB_TOKEN` - Fixes #462
